Why Fantasy City Names Matter
Fantasy city names are more than just words; they're the first brushstrokes on the canvas of your readers' imagination. A well-crafted city name can evoke images of towering spires, bustling markets, or ancient ruins. It can hint at the city's history, culture, and even its secrets. In essence, a great fantasy city name is a promise to your readers, a promise of worlds yet unexplored.
The Anatomy of a Fantasy City Name
Before we dive into the fun part—creating our own fantasy city names—let's break down what makes a city name captivating.
1. Phonetics: Music to the Ears
A city name should roll off the tongue like a spell. It should sound pleasing, even if it's not immediately recognizable. Think of names like "Mistralys" or "Valoren". They might not mean anything to us, but they sound beautiful, don't they?
2. Length: Size Matters
The length of a city name can also convey a lot. Longer names often suggest ancient, complex histories. Shorter names might hint at simplicity or isolation. For example, "New York" is short and to the point, while "Aerendyl" or "Celestia" are names that seem to have evolved over centuries.
3. Meaning: A Story in Every Name
The best fantasy city names have meaning. This could be a literal meaning, like "Starsfall" suggesting a city that fell from the stars, or a metaphorical one, like "Shadowhaven" hinting at a city that thrives in the shadows. Even if your readers don't know the exact meaning, a name that seems to carry a story can pique their interest.
Crafting Your Own Fantasy City Names
Now that we know what makes a great fantasy city name, let's create some of our own!
1. Draw Inspiration from Everywhere
The world is your oyster when it comes to inspiration. Look to history, mythology, other languages, nature, even music. Anything can spark an idea for a city name.
2. Combine and Conquer
One of the easiest ways to create unique fantasy city names is to combine words. This could be as simple as pairing an adjective with a noun, like "Whispering Woods" or "Glimmering Spire". You can also combine words from different languages or create entirely new words.
3. Use Sound Changes
Another way to create new words is to change the sound of an existing one. This is called sound symbolism, and it's a powerful tool in world-building. For example, adding an "n" or "m" sound to the end of a word can make it sound more magical or mysterious. Think "Arcanum" or "Mystra".
4. Don't Be Afraid to Break the Rules
While it's helpful to have guidelines, don't be afraid to break them once in a while. A city name that's an exception to the rules can be just as captivating as one that fits the mold.
